Boy taken from WA school may be in danger, police say

Police are appealing for help in the hunt for the seven-year-old boy.

A seven-year-old boy taken from his school by a family member in Perth may be in imminent danger, police say.

Phoenix White was taken from his school in Harrisdale by a man at about 9.40am on Wednesday.

The man was riding a red/black motorcycle, believed to be a Yamaha.

"Information obtained since that time suggests Phoenix may be in imminent danger," police said on Wednesday afternoon.

Phoenix was last seen travelling on Tonkin Highway, near Hale Road.

He is described as fair skinned, about 140cm tall, with a stocky build and blonde hair.

He was wearing blue shorts, a navy blue polo shirt with green side panels, a navy blue jacket and black shoes.

Anyone with information should call police on 000.
